The effective annual rate is the rate that, under annual compounding, would have produced the same future value at the end of 1 year as was produced by more frequent compounding, say quarterly. The nominal (quoted) interest rate, iNom, is the rate of interest stated in a contract.

The monthly interest rate is: (0.10/12) = 0.008333 = 0.8333 percent. Therefore, the effective annual interest rate on the loan is: (1.008333)12 ( 1 = 0.1047 = 10.47 percent. 22. a.
